Touring cycling around Rheden offers diverse landscapes, from the rolling hills and dense forests of Veluwezoom National Park to the flat floodplains of the IJssel River. The region is characterized by varied terrain, including expansive heathlands and sand drifts, providing a range of experiences for cyclists. Notable features like the Posbank offer panoramic views and challenging climbs, while the river valleys provide more serene routes.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available in Rheden?

There are over 340 no-traffic touring cycling routes around Rheden, offering a wide range of options for all skill levels. These routes are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ars.

What kind of terrain can I expect on no-traffic touring cycling routes in Rheden?

Rheden offers a diverse cycling landscape. Within the Veluwezoom National Park, you'll find rolling hills, dense forests, and expansive heathlands, including the notable Posbank with its panoramic views and challenging climbs. Towards the eastern boundary, the IJssel River floodplains provide contrasting, flatter terrain. This mix caters to both those seeking a physical challenge and those preferring a more leisurely ride.

What are some notable landmarks or viewpoints I can see along these routes?

Rheden's no-traffic routes offer access to several beautiful sights. Within Veluwezoom National Park, you can enjoy the panoramic views from the Posbank, especially during the heather bloom. Other notable viewpoints include the Löns Tower on Thüster Berg and the Ernst-Binnewies Tower (Tafelbergturm) on Hohe Tafel. You might also encounter historical sites like Castle Middachten or Castle Rosendael, and natural features such as the Lippold's Cave.

What is the best time of year for no-traffic touring cycling in Rheden?

The best times for cycling in Rheden are during spring and autumn. Temperatures are mild, and nature is vibrant, with spring offering fresh greenery and autumn showcasing beautiful foliage. August is particularly special for the purple heather bloom on the Posbank. While winter cycling is possible, some services or conditions might be less ideal.
